You’ll be the go-to person for our Trade customers. Representing the team on our Trade Sales Counter, you’ll help our Trade customers, predominately plumbers and electricians, to get exactly what they need for the job. You don’t need to be an expert about Trade, it’s all about relationship building. With the help of our excellent training programmes and varied shift patterns to support a healthy work life balance, you’ll be on the right track for a promising career with us!
Contracted hours available (To be worked flexibly across Monday to Sunday on a rota basis, with early mornings and late evenings included).
- 17.5 hours per week
- 35.75 hours per week
What’s it like to be a Supervisor?
- Get to know your customers – you’ll chat to them over a cuppa, understand their projects and offer advice to drive sales. The relationships you and your team build will make us their trusted, go-to retailer.
- Run your own business within a business – You’ll take ownership of all your own KPI’s including Sales, account increasing, on-boarding new customers and giving great service.
- Inspire your team – following your lead, you’ll guide and coach the team to do great things, building a reputation of your store to be proud of.

How to prepare for a job interview at Screwfix
✨Know Your Customers
Before the interview, think about how you would build relationships with Trade customers. Be ready to share examples of how you've connected with clients in the past, especially in a sales or service role. This will show your understanding of the importance of customer relationships.
✨Show Your Enthusiasm for Learning
Make sure to express your eagerness to learn and grow within the role. Highlight any relevant experiences where you’ve taken the initiative to develop your skills. This aligns perfectly with their focus on training and personal development.
✨Demonstrate Team Leadership Skills
Prepare to discuss your experience in guiding and inspiring a team. Think of specific instances where you’ve motivated others or taken ownership of a project. This will resonate well with their need for someone who can lead and coach a team effectively.
✨Be Flexible and Reliable
Since the role involves varied shift patterns, be ready to talk about your flexibility and reliability. Share examples of how you’ve managed your time and commitments in previous jobs, showing that you can adapt to different working hours without compromising on performance.
